Beetle juice 2continuation of Ghosts have fun 1988, received a new trailer this Thursday (23) and finally revealed more details about Willem Dafoe, who will play a new character in the sequel. Starring Jenna Ortega as the lead, the film also features the returns of Michael Keaton, Winona Ryder and Catherine O’Hara in their original roles.
New to the cast, Ortega will play the daughter of Lydia, the character played by Ryder in the original, while Dafoe, famous for being the Green Goblin in the film Spidermanhe will be a police officer in the afterlife: a ghost.
Ghosts have fun tells the story of a recently deceased couple (Geena Davis and Alec Baldwin) who haunt their old house. I am extremely uncomfortable with the arrival of a new family (Catherine O’Hara, Jeffrey Jones and Ryder).
Then they come into contact with Beetlejuice, a ghost of the dead social worker who promises to help them haunt the new inhabitants.
